学习函数最大的目的就是给我们省劲儿,它可以对代码复用。 函数定义一次,可以无限制的调用。 逻辑修改的时候,只要改函数定义里就可以了。 通过参数,我们可以得出不同的结果。JavaScript函数是什么?JavaScript 函数是被设计为执行特定任务的代码块,它里面是一系列的逻辑运算。JavaScript 函数会在某代码调用它时被执行。JavaScript函数使用的流程大概是以下几步:定义、调用、返
转载
2023-06-26 16:23:16
146阅读
Javascript函数调用函数调用函数定义后,并不会自动执行,需要通过调用来实现。在JS中调用通常有四种方式:函数调用模式;方法调用模式;构造器调用模式;apply、call调用模式;其中函数调用模式的语法是:函数名([实参列表]);若实参缺省时,会传“undefined”值给对应的形参;如果实参个数小于形参个数,实参首先按顺序一一对应传给形参,没有实参对应的形参,就会对应传“undefined
转载
2023-05-22 10:29:14
216阅读
JavaScript 函数有 4 种调用方式。
每种方式的不同在于 this 的初始化。
转载
2018-07-23 11:21:00
182阅读
函数的作用就是封装一段JavaScript代码,让开发者可以通古简单的方式使用这段代码
一、函数的分类
在几乎所有的编程语言中,都有函数这一概念,并且没中语言本身都继承了丰富的函数,这类函数被称为系统函数或者内置函数,系统函数在语言设计时就已经定义好了,开发者根据语言的开发手册学习使用就可以
js的系统函数可以分为数学函数、时间函数、字符串函数等
二、自定义函数
自定义函数就是开发者自己定
原创
2024-01-19 21:49:39
81阅读
函数的编写与使用 在程序设计语言中函数是一段具有特殊功能的代码,同时也是一组可以重复使用的代码。通过函数这一对象的使用,进一步提高了程序开发的模块化与高度多的代码复用性。各种程序设计语言都对函数的定义及使用有着严格的语法规则。本文主要介绍如何在JavaScript中定义函数、使用函数,并对递归函数这一特殊类型函数进行说明。JavaScript函数基本语法JavaScript中所定义的函数主
转载
2024-06-02 19:28:15
48阅读
函数函数是一组语句的集合,它是一个独立运行的程序单元。本质上,它是一段子程序,函数是JavaScript的核心。每一个函数都有一个函数体,它是构成该函数的一组语句集合。函数声明完后需要调用(也称为运行、执行、请求或者调度)才会去执行函数体。函数的定义第一种定义方式:函数声明function 函数名(){
函数体
}第二种定义方式:函数表达式var 变量 = function(){
函数体
}注
转载
2023-08-20 19:50:34
116阅读
1、在Javascript定义一个函数一般有如下方式:// 函数关键字(function)语句:
function fun(x){alert(x);}
// 函数字面量(Function Literals):
var fun = function(x){alert(x);}
//Function()构造函数:
var fun = new Function('x','alert(x);')2、回
转载
2023-06-06 16:48:19
214阅读
函数的定义与调用1:函数的定义 语法格式function 函数名(数据类型 参数1){//function是定义函数的关键字
方法体;//statements,用于实现函数功能的语句
[返回值return expression]//expression可选参数,用于返回函数值
}
//1:函数名:
转载
2023-05-27 12:08:21
50阅读
函数对任何语言来说都是一个核心的概念。函数,是一种封装(将一些语句,封装到函数里面)。通过函数可以封装任意多条语句,而且可以在任何地方、任何时候调用执行。ECMAScript中的函数使用function关键字来声明,后跟一组参数以及函数体,也就是包裹在花括号中的代码块,前面使用了关键词 function:当调用该函数时,会执行函数内的代码。function 函数名(){ 执行代码}创
转载
2023-06-09 08:40:57
50阅读
JavaScrpit入门(三)-函数一、何为函数?JavaScript 函数是被设计为执行特定任务的代码块。JavaScript 函数会在某代码调用它时被执行。这里采用w3school-JavaScript函数给的定义。使用函数,能有效时结构高内聚、低耦合。在JavaScript中函数作为一种引用变量存在,在特性上颇具特色。二、学习函数须知函数也是一种数据类型,被划为为引用类型变量开发命名规范:当
转载
2024-02-11 22:00:25
37阅读
JavaScript函数是一种基于对象的脚本语言,JavaScript代码复用的单位是函数。JavaScript中的函数可以独立存在,而且JavaScript中的函数完全可以作为一个类来使用(而且它还是该类的唯一的构造器)。函数也可以是一个对象,函数本身就是Function实例。以下是定义函数的3中方式:定义命名函数<script type="text/javascript">
转载
2023-09-21 22:48:56
32阅读
JavaScript 函数2.1 初始函数在 JavaScript 中,函数类似于 Java 中的方法,是执行特定功能的 JavaScript 代码。但是 JavaScript 中的函数使用更简单,不用定义函数属于哪个类,因此调用时不需要用"对象.函数名()"的方式。直接使用函数名称来调用函数即可。JavaScript 中有函数有两种:一种时 JavaScript 自带的系统函数,另一种时用户自行
转载
2023-08-26 23:01:07
52阅读
JavaScript函数的声明函数概念:是由事件驱动的或者当他被调用时可执行的可重复使用的代码块。函数常见的两种声明方式声明式:必须以function关键字开头,后跟一组参数以及函数体。
基本语法如下所示:function 函数名(参数1,参数2,...) {
// 代码
}
// 函数的名字,自定义(遵循变量名的命名规则和命名规范)
// ()是用来放参数的位置,个数 >= 0
// {
转载
2023-06-06 16:56:30
75阅读
JavaScript之函数篇一、函数的定义和调用1. 函数定义2. 调用函数二、变量作用域与解构赋值1. 变量声明及其作用域2. 解构赋值(ES6)三、方法1.关键字`this`2.`apply`四、高阶函数1. map/reduce2. filter3. sort4. Array五、闭包六、箭头函数(ES6)七、generator JavaScript中的函数可以像变量一样使用,具很强的抽象能
转载
2024-04-10 08:46:20
56阅读
一、JavaScript函数1.1、函数的基本概念在JS里面,可能会定义非常多的相同代码或者功能相似的代码,这些代码可能需要大量重复使用。 虽然for循环语句也能实现一些简单的重复操作,但是比较具有局限性,此时我们就可以使用JS中的函数。函数:就是封装了一段可被重复调用执行的代码块。通过此代码块可以实现大量代码的重复使用。1.2、函数的使用函数在使用时分为两步:声明函数和调用函数function是
转载
2024-02-22 13:40:43
11阅读
本文主要分析了JavaScript中函数的几种写法,具体如下:1、函数的声明和表达式(旧方法,也是最常见的方法)//函数声明
function aaA(){}//命名函数表达式
(function aaA(){});
//需要注意的是,因为整个表达式被一对()包裹,函数的作用于仅仅在()内,在()外部无法访问到函数//匿名函数表达式
(function (){});2、通过Function构造器这
转载
2023-06-19 17:12:07
68阅读
自定义函数就是开发者自己定义的函数,其代码处理逻辑有开发者指定,用来满足项目开发中一些特性的需求。
原创
2024-03-07 09:18:17
35阅读
函数实际上是对象。每个函数都是 Function 类型的实例,而且与其他引用类型都一样具有属性和方法。函数名是一个指向函数对象的指针,它不会与某个函数绑定。函数通常使用函数声明语法定义:function sum(num1, num2) {
return num1 + num2;
}也可以使用函数的构造函数定义:var sum = function(num1, num2)
转载
2023-08-20 14:04:27
49阅读
此处总结到的 js 数组操作函数有:push,pop,join,shift,unshift,slice,splice,concat(1)push 和 pop这两个函数都是对数组从尾部进行压入或弹出操作。push(arg1,arg2,…)可以每次压入一个或多个元素,并返回更新后的数组长度。注意如果参数也是数组的话,则是将全部数组当做一个元素压入到原本的数组里面去。pop() 函数则每次只会弹出结尾的
转载
2023-08-08 10:47:10
53阅读
函数
1.函数的定义
(1)function 函数名(x){ 函数执行体; }
(2)var 函数名=function(x){ 函数执行体; };
这种方法说明,在javascript中,函数就是一种对象,也就是说,函数也是一种数据类型,参数列表相当于函数的入口,return相当于函数的出口。
如:var ab
转载
2023-10-06 11:29:39
180阅读